Article Overview
Cap-type splice boxes protect fiber optic connections while splicing and connector techniques ensure low-loss, reliable fiber network performance.
Cap-Type Connector Boxes
A cap-type splice box is a protective enclosure designed to house and organize fiber optic splices, providing environmental protection and mechanical stability . Its dome or cap-style closure creates a sealed environment that prevents moisture, dust, and contaminants from affecting fiber splices, which is critical for maintaining signal integrity . Key features include:
- Environmental sealing: Protects fibers from water ingress, dust, and physical stress.
- Internal trays and routing paths: Keep fibers neatly arranged, reducing bending or tangling.
- Ease of access: Technicians can efficiently install or repair fibers without compromising protection.
- Versatility: Suitable for aerial, pole-mounted, buried, or ducted installations, and supports multiple fiber connections in residential or commercial networks .
Fiber Optic Cable Techniques
Fiber optic cables transmit data as light pulses through a glass core surrounded by cladding and protective layers . Techniques for connecting fibers include splicing and connectors:
Splicing
Splices create permanent joints between fibers and are classified into:
- Fusion splicing: Uses heat to fuse fiber ends, offering low loss and high reliability. It has a higher initial cost but lower per-connection cost .
- Mechanical splicing: Aligns fiber ends using a precision device, allowing light to pass through. It has a lower initial cost but slightly higher loss (typically ~0.3 dB) and higher per-splice cost . Proper alignment of fiber cores is critical to minimize optical loss, which can result from poor core alignment, axial run-out, or improper cleaving angles .
Connectors
Fiber optic connectors provide temporary, removable connections and are essential for maintenance and flexibility . Common types include:
- SC (Subscriber Connector): Square shape, push-pull coupling, widely used in FTTH and data centers.
- LC (Lucent Connector): Miniaturized SC, 1.25mm ferrule, ideal for high-density applications.
- ST (Straight Tip): Bayonet-style twist-lock, used in legacy or industrial networks.
- FC (Ferrule Connector): Threaded coupling, secure in high-vibration environments . Connectors use ceramic ferrules to align fibers precisely, ensuring low insertion loss and minimal reflectance. Singlemode fibers often require factory-made pigtails or splice-on connectors for reliable termination, while multimode fibers can be field-terminated more easily .
Best Practices
- Ensure environmental protection using cap-type boxes for splices.
- Choose appropriate splicing or connector methods based on fiber type, network density, and maintenance needs.
- Maintain proper fiber alignment to minimize optical loss.
- Follow FOA standards for installation, handling, and testing to ensure network reliability . By combining cap-type splice boxes with proper splicing and connector techniques, fiber optic networks achieve durability, low signal loss, and ease of maintenance across diverse deployment scenarios.
